Rodney Davis’ Newest Claim to Fame: One of Republicans’ Most Vulnerable

 Today, Republican leadership added Congressman Davis to their list of most vulnerable incumbents, their latest move in shoring up an incumbent who has clearly become too comfortable within the ranks of party leadership in the eyes of Illinoisans. Davis is so entrenched in Republican ranks, he went so far as to refuse to return the $10,000 given him by former Congressman Aaron Schock.

“Time after time, Congressman Davis has voted against the interests of Illinois veterans, students, and hardworking families, so it’s no wonder he’s turning to his Washington pals to help him out,” said Matt Thornton of the DCCC. “Congressman Davis probably hopes to distract Illinoisans from his votes to slash Pell grants and stifle transportation funding, as well as his continued implication in an ethical scandal involving disgraced former Congressman Aaron Schock, but Illinois voters know better than to be fooled.”
